Step-by-step Preparation of Homemade Caesar Salad Dressing
Creating your very own homemade Caesar salad dressing is a delightful journey that transforms simple ingredients into a rich and creamy delight. It’s not just about flavor; it’s also about ensuring that you have complete control over what goes into your dressing. Let’s dive in!
Gather your ingredients
Before you embark on this flavorful adventure, make sure to gather all your ingredients. Here’s what you’ll need:
- 2 small garlic cloves, minced
- 1 teaspoon anchovy paste
- 2 tablespoons freshly squeezed lemon juice (from one lemon)
- 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ard (Maille is a great choice)
- 1 teaspoon Worcestershire sauce
- 1 cup best quality mayonnaise (I recommend Hellmann's Real)
- ½ cup freshly grated Parmigiano-Reggiano
- ¼ teaspoon salt
- ¼ teaspoon freshly ground black pepper

Whisk together the base ingredients
In a medium bowl, combine the essential base ingredients: the minced garlic, anchovy paste, lemon juice, Dijon mustard, and Worcestershire sauce. Use a whisk to blend them into a smooth mixture. Incorporate mayonnaise and cheese
Now for the star of the show: the mayonnaise! Add a cup of your favorite mayonnaise to the base mixture, followed by the freshly grated Parmigiano-Reggiano. This is where your dressing will truly gain its creamy richness. Keep whisking until everything is unified into a velvety blend that is simply irresistible.
Adjust seasoning to taste
Give your homemade Caesar salad dressing a taste test! At this stage, adjust the seasoning by adding salt and freshly ground black pepper. It might need just a pinch more salt or a squeeze of lemon, depending on your preference. Make it perfect for your palate—it’s your creation after all!
Store your dressing properly
Once your dressing reaches its desired flavor profile, it’s time to store it. Transfer your homemade Caesar salad dressing into an airtight container and pop it in the fridge. It’ll stay fresh for about a week. Just give it a good shake before serving to revive those flavors.

Variations on Homemade Caesar Salad Dressing
Elevate your homemade Caesar salad dressing with these delightful twists that cater to a variety of tastes!
Creamy Avocado Caesar Dressing
For a luscious, creamy twist, blend ripe avocados into your dressing. Simply replace half of the mayonnaise with mashed avocado and add a splash more lemon juice. This not only enhances the flavor but also brings in healthy fats. It’s a fantastic way to boost nutrition while keeping that classic Caesar vibe.
Vegan Caesar Dressing Alternatives
If you’re looking to keep things plant-based, swap out the mayo for silken tofu or a vegan mayo. Add nutritional yeast for a cheesy flavor and increase the flavor depth with capers instead of anchovies. You’ll enjoy a totally plant-based Caesar dressing that’s undeniably delicious!
Spicy Caesar Dressing Twist
For those who crave a kick, mix in some sriracha or a dash of red pepper flakes. Just a teaspoon will transform your dressing into a spicy sensation that pairs beautifully with crisp romaine. It’s a fun way to jazz up your salads if you’re in the mood for something more adventurous!

Cooking Tips and Notes for Homemade Caesar Salad Dressing
Choosing the Right Garlic
When making homemade Caesar salad dressing, the garlic you select can make a significant difference. Choose fresh, firm garlic bulbs rather than pre-peeled or dried flakes. If you enjoy a milder flavor, consider using roasted garlic for a sweeter, more subtle taste.
Storing the Dressing for Maximum Freshness
To keep your dressing at its best, store it in an airtight container in the fridge. It should last about a week—if it lasts that long! Just give it a good shake or stir before using to redistribute the ingredients.
How to Enhance Flavors
To elevate your homemade Caesar salad dressing, try adding a dash of hot sauce or a sprinkle of crushed red pepper flakes for some heat. Fresh herbs like parsley or chives can also brighten the flavor profile. Taste as you go and enjoy experimenting!

FAQs about Homemade Caesar Salad Dressing
Can I skip the anchovy paste?
Absolutely! If you're not a fan of anchovies or simply want to keep things vegetarian, feel free to skip the anchovy paste in your homemade Caesar salad dressing. You can substitute it with a teaspoon of capers for a similar umami kick. Just remember, this may slightly alter the flavor, but it will still be delicious!
How long does the dressing last in the fridge?
Your creamy homemade Caesar salad dressing can typically last up to a week in the fridge when stored in an airtight container. If you notice any changes in texture or smell, it’s best to discard it. Always give it a good whisk before serving, as some separation may occur.
Tips for making it healthier?
Looking to lighten things up? Here are some suggestions:
- Use Greek yogurt instead of mayonnaise for a tangy twist and lower fat content.
- Reduce the cheese by half or try using a lower-fat variety of Parmigiano-Reggiano.
- Add a bit of fresh herbs, such as parsley or basil, to increase flavor without extra calories.

Homemade Caesar Salad Dressing
Equipment
- medium bowl
Ingredients
Ingredients
- 2 cloves garlic minced
- 1 teaspoon anchovy paste see note
- 2 tablespoons freshly squeezed lemon juice from one lemon
- 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ard preferably Maille
- 1 teaspoon Worcestershire sauce
- 1 cup mayonnaise best quality, such as Hellmann's Real
- ½ cup freshly grated Parmigiano-Reggiano
- ¼ teaspoon salt
- ¼ te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
Instructions
Instructions
- In a medium bowl, whisk together the garlic, anchovy paste, lemon juice, Dijon mustard, and Worcestershire sauce. Add the mayonnaise, Parmigiano-Reggiano, salt, and pepper and whisk until well combined. Taste and adjust to your liking. The dressing will keep well in the fridge for about a week.
- Note: Anchovy paste can be found near the canned tuna in the supermarket.
